La*pid"i*fy, v. t. [imp. & p. p. Lapidified; p. pr. & vb. n. Lapidifying.] Etym: [Cf. f. lapidifier. See Lapidific, and -fy.]
Definition: To convert into stone or stony material; to petrify.
La*pid"i*fy, v. i.
Definition: To become stone or stony
